Macaroni Cheese Foundations in the South

Southern Macaroni Cheese centers on a creamy sauce, starch-safe textures, and a cheese blend that tolerates a hot oven without curdling. The dish starts with pasta cooked just shy of al dente, giving the final bake something to cling to and a perfect bite in every forkful.

Crucially, the sauce must merge smoothly with the pasta. Layering flavor through stock, a gentle roux or béchamel, and a well-chosen cheese mix creates depth, yielding a lush interior and a crust that browns like a well-seasoned cast iron skillet.

Macaroni Cheese Ingredients

First, select pasta that holds sauce well—short shapes like elbow or small shells are preferred for Southern appeal. A robust mix of cheeses—sharp cheddar, Gruyère, and a mozzarella pull—delivers both flavor and melt, while a touch of cream or milk keeps the sauce luxurious without heaviness.

For a richer crust, consider a breadcrumb topping with butter, garlic, and a hint of paprika. A pinch of mustard powder or cayenne adds spark without overpowering the cheese, and a few beaten eggs can help the final bake set into slices that hold their shape.

Macaroni Cheese Sauce Techniques

Whisk equal parts flour and butter into a pale blonde roux. Slowly whisk in warm milk to form a smooth, glossy base before folding in the cheese. This foundation prevents gritty textures and helps the sauce cling to every pasta piece.

The sauce should carry the hallmarks of Southern flavor—nutty cheddar, a hint of tang from a well-aged cheese, and a whisper of cream to guarantee a silky finish. Don’t rush the cheese; add it off heat to avoid breaking the emulsion and creating a greasy sheen.

Salt at every stage to build a baseline that makes cheese flavors pop without tasting flat. Taste and adjust as it cooks. The texture should be velvety, not gluey, and the cheese should sing rather than shout.

⚠️ Pro-Caution
Pro-Caution: Overheating the sauce or adding cheese too quickly can cause separation. Gentle heat and gradual incorporation preserve the glossy finish essential to Macaroni Cheese.

Macaroni Cheese Crust, Bake, and Finish

The clock runs during the bake. A high oven (425°F to 450°F / 220°C to 230°C) encourages a deep, golden crust while the interior remains creamy. A crust can be built with breadcrumbs, butter, and grated cheese or with a more rustic topping like crushed crackers mixed with olive oil.

For a sharper crust, finish with a quick under-broil blast at the end of baking. Watch closely to avoid scorching. The goal is a browned, crisp crown that contrasts with the tender, saucy core—an texture trick that elevates the dish beyond a simple casserole.

Can I modify Macaroni Cheese for dietary needs without losing flavor?

Yes. For lighter versions, reduce butter and replace whole milk with milk or a non-dairy alternative that suits your needs, while maintaining a cheese blend that melts well. You still need a stable sauce base—roux or béchamel—so the texture remains cohesive.

Flavor can be boosted with seasonings, smoked paprika, mustard powder, or a touch of hot sauce. Substituting part of the cheese with a plant-based option is possible, but aim for a similar melt and tang to preserve the dish’s character. The core technique remains the same: gentle heat, steady emulsification, and a balanced finish.

What are practical tips to ensure a crispy, flavorful crust every time?

Use a buttered breadcrumb topping with a touch of cheese to form a crisp barrier. Bake on a rack to ensure air circulation around the dish, which helps browning. A final blast under the broiler completes the crust without overcooking the interior.

Season the topping lightly; salt and spice up the crust so it complements rather than overpowers the creamy interior. The topping should shadow the sauce’s richness, adding texture and a savory aroma that entices before the first bite.
